Mapping the Invisible: A Breakthrough in Cosmic Magnetism

Magnetic fields are invisible forces that shape the behavior of plasma and particles across the universe, yet mapping them on a cosmic scale has long been a challenge. Recently, astronomers achieved a breakthrough by reconstructing the magnetic field of a galaxy cluster with unprecedented detail. This record-breaking map reveals the hidden architecture of one of the largest structures in the universe, offering new insights into the dynamics of intergalactic space.

The study focused on a massive galaxy cluster, a gravitational bound group of hundreds or thousands of galaxies. Using data from radio telescopes, researchers measured the polarization of light emitted by electrons spiraling along magnetic field lines. This technique, known as Faraday rotation, allowed them to infer the strength and direction of the magnetic fields permeating the cluster’s hot gas.

The resulting map is a testament to the power of modern observational astronomy. It shows that the magnetic fields are not random but follow a structured pattern, likely influenced by the motion of galaxies and the turbulence of the intracluster medium. These fields play a crucial role in regulating the flow of heat and energy, affecting how galaxies form and evolve within the cluster.

Understanding these magnetic structures is essential for cosmology. They act as scaffolding for cosmic rays and influence the distribution of matter on large scales. By reconstructing the field, scientists can better model the physical processes that govern the growth of structure in the universe, from small galaxies to massive clusters.
